Thirty-Eighth Parallel
A line of latitude that is often referred to as the pre-Korean War boundary between North Korea and South Korea.
Defensive Alliance
An agreement between nations to provide mutual support in case one of them is attacked by a third party.
West Germany
The informal name for the Federal Republic of Germany during the period from its formation in 1949 until German reunification in 1990, contrasting with East Germany, the German Democratic Republic.
